From: Mike Blumenkrantz Date: Wed, 22 Jul 2015 20:28:08 +0000 (-0400) Subject: don't update wl keyboard state on client focus events X-Git-Tag: upstream/0.20.0~521 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=435bd8794a12a1afef4134ba40ccc0128f505c1a;p=platform%2Fupstream%2Fenlightenment.git don't update wl keyboard state on client focus events this is always up-to-date --- diff --git a/src/bin/e_comp_wl.c b/src/bin/e_comp_wl.c index 13b32c6..4eac7a3 100644 --- a/src/bin/e_comp_wl.c +++ b/src/bin/e_comp_wl.c @@ -499,10 +499,6 @@ _e_comp_wl_evas_cb_focus_in(void *data, Evas *evas EINA_UNUSED, Evas_Object *obj /* raise client priority */ _e_comp_wl_client_priority_raise(ec); - /* update keyboard modifier state */ - wl_array_for_each(k, &e_comp->wl_comp_data->kbd.keys) - e_comp_wl_input_keyboard_state_update(*k, EINA_TRUE); - e_comp_wl_input_keyboard_enter_send(ec); } @@ -520,10 +516,6 @@ _e_comp_wl_evas_cb_focus_out(void *data, Evas *evas EINA_UNUSED, Evas_Object *ob cdata = e_comp->wl_comp_data; - /* update keyboard modifier state */ - wl_array_for_each(k, &cdata->kbd.keys) - e_comp_wl_input_keyboard_state_update(*k, EINA_FALSE); - if (e_object_is_del(E_OBJECT(ec))) return; /* lower client priority */